Naturalistic Observation
A descriptive technique of observing and recording behavior in naturally occurring situations without trying to manipulate and control the situation.
Internal Locus of Control
A belief system wherein individuals feel that they have control over the outcomes of events in their lives, as opposed to external forces.
Type B Personality
A personality type characterized by a less competitive, more relaxed, and less stressed-out demeanor compared to Type A Personality.
